Best Time to Visit

Timing is crucial when planning a budget-friendly trip to Disneyland Paris. Avoid peak seasons like summer holidays, school holidays, Disneyland Paris Holidays, Christmas, and Easter when the park is busiest and prices are highest.

Instead, aim for the quieter periods – mid-January to mid-March or mid-April to mid-June. During these times, not only are the park ticket and accommodation costs lower, but you’ll also benefit from shorter queues for attractions.

Plus, the mild weather in these months makes for a comfortable visit.

Booking Park Tickets

Advance Disneyland Paris tickets purchase is key to saving money.

Keep an eye on Disneyland Paris’s official website for special deals to Paris Disneyland and discounts. Sometimes, they offer seasonal promotions or special packages that include extras like meal plans or additional park days.

Buying tickets for multiple days usually reduces the daily cost, and if you plan to visit more than once a year, consider an annual pass for even greater savings.

Choosing the Right Pass

Understanding the different ticket options can significantly impact your budget. Disneyland Paris offers various types of passes – from single-day, single-park tickets to multi-day, multi-park passes.

Assess your interests and time availability to select the most cost-effective option. If you’re keen on experiencing both Disneyland Park and Walt Disney Studios Park, a multi-park ticket is essential.

However, if you’re short on time or have specific attractions you want to see, a single-park ticket could suffice.

Accommodation Options

Staying off-site away from Disneyland Paris hotels can significantly reduce costs. Numerous hotels in the surrounding area offer comfortable stays at a fraction of the price of Disney hotels.

Many provide free shuttle services to the parks, adding convenience to your stay.

Alternatively, consider Airbnb options or budget hostels for an even more economical stay.

Flights and Trains

For international visitors, flying into Paris is often the most common way to reach Disneyland Paris. To find budget-friendly airfares, using SkyScanner is highly recommended.

It’s an excellent platform for comparing prices across various airlines, ensuring you get the best deal available. By booking your flights well in advance and considering budget airlines, significant savings can be achieved.

Once in Paris, the most cost-effective way to reach Disneyland Paris is by RER train. The RER A train runs directly from the city center to Disneyland Paris, offering both convenience and affordability for travelers.

Eating at Disneyland Paris on a Budget

Dining in Disneyland Paris can be one of the larger expenses, but there are ways to eat well without overspending.

Bringing your own snacks and refillable water bottles can save a significant amount over purchasing similar items in the park. For meals, consider the counter-service restaurants, which offer more affordable options than sit-down dining.

Look out for meal combos, which often include a main, side, and drink at a lower price than buying these items separately.

Another tip is to have a substantial breakfast before entering the park, reducing the need for a large, expensive lunch.

Smart Souvenir Shopping

When souvenir shopping at Disneyland Paris, set a clear budget to avoid impulse purchases and focus on unique items specific to the park for more memorable keepsakes.

Prices can vary between shops, so compare before buying and consider visiting the Disney Village for potentially lower prices and a less crowded experience.

Look out for seasonal sales and special promotions, which can offer great deals. For a more budget-friendly approach, small items like postcards or keychains can be delightful and affordable.

Alternatively, collect free memorabilia like park maps and tickets to create a personalized scrapbook of your visit, a creative and cost-effective way to preserve your memories.

Maximizing Ride and Attraction Experiences

To get the most out of your visit without extra expenses like FastPasses, strategic planning is essential.

Use the Disneyland Paris app to check wait times and plan your route through the park, targeting popular attractions during typically less busy times, like during parades or in the evening.

Make use of Extra Magic Hours if you’re staying at a Disney hotel, which allows early park access.

Additionally, consider visiting popular rides during meal times when lines are often shorter. Being flexible with your schedule can also pay off; sometimes, joining a longer line just before the park closes lets you enjoy a final ride with less wait.

Finally, don’t overlook the single rider lines available at certain attractions, as they can significantly reduce your waiting time.

Free and Low-Cost Attractions

Parades and Shows

One of the highlights of Disneyland Paris that doesn’t cost extra is its spectacular parades and shows.

The daily parade is a must-see, featuring beloved Disney characters and stunning floats. Evening shows like ‘Disney Illuminations’ at Sleeping Beauty Castle offer an unforgettable experience with fireworks, light projections, and music.

These events are included in your park admission and are perfect for creating lasting memories.

Free Attractions

Beyond the big-ticket rides, Disneyland Paris is filled with attractions and experiences that don’t require additional spending.

Stroll through the whimsical Alice’s Curious Labyrinth, enjoy the enchanting ambiance of Fantasyland, or explore the pirate-themed Adventure Isle.

Don’t miss the opportunity to wander around the park and soak in the detailed theming and architecture, which is an attraction in itself.

Disneyland Paris on a Budget with Kids

Managing Expectations

Managing expectations, especially when visiting Disneyland Paris with children, is a crucial part of enjoying a budget-conscious trip.

Before the trip, have a conversation with your kids about the budget, including what kinds of souvenirs and treats are feasible. This not only helps to prevent disappointment but also involves them in the planning process, making them feel more engaged and responsible.

Discuss the attractions and experiences that are most important to them, so you can prioritize these within your schedule and budget.

Finally, remind them (and yourself) that Disneyland is about making magical memories, which doesn’t always require spending money.

Kid-Friendly Budget Activities

Disneyland Paris is brimming with activities that delight children without additional costs.

Prioritize character meet-and-greets, where memories are made with favorite Disney personalities.

The park’s numerous playgrounds offer a break for parents while kids enjoy themselves. Don’t miss the free shows and parades, perfect for captivating young minds.

Encourage exploration of themed areas like Adventure Isle or Alice’s Curious Labyrinth, which provide immersive experiences at no extra cost.
